#623b75 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#623b75 is composed of 38.4% red, 23.1%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.2%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 280.3 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 34.5%. #623b75 color hex could be obtained by blending #c476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#623b75 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#623b75 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#623b75 has RGB values of R:98, G:59,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 6437749.

Shades and Tints of #623b75
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b060d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#623b75
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59565a is the less saturated color, while #7505ab is the most saturated one.
